Research Interests

I mainly research precision engineering measurement and deformation monitoring, focusing on repetition survey of precision measurement control network of high-speed railway in operation, basic deformation monitoring technology of high-speed railway and track slab automatic detection. Based on the monitoring of the high-speed railway in operation, after a long period of research, our research group have established a complete consultation and evaluation system for repetition survey of preciseion measurement control network of high-speed railway in operation and basic deformation monitoring technology of high-speed railway, and developed a complete precision measurement control network data processing and analysis system. And a new track slab rapid detection system was developed to realize the automatic detection of CRTS III track slab dimensions of high-speed railway. In the future, we will focus on track monitoring technology of long-span combined highway and railway bridge.
